I've been having a reoccurring problem recently. In my 10 gallon community, my guppies have been dying off one by one. First, they get clamped fins and become sluggish. They aren't as active and seem to have less of an appetite. Before they die, their innards seem to prolapse outside of their body. I've tried to include a picture. It's a little hard to see with the flash, so I've doctored up the picture so it isn't as bright. But you can see what appears to be the intestine coming out of the end of the fish. So far, it only seems to be happening to my guppies. My sparkling gourami and platies don't seem to be suffering from whatever is causing this.
